At least 23 people were killed and more than 50 injured, some critically, after a car bomb exploded near a bus terminal in the Khyber tribal region in north-west Pakistan.

According to police investigations, the bomb had been planted in a car in the busy market area of Jamrud and was detonated remotely.

Several other vehicles were also damaged by the blast.

The Khyber tribal region is known for previous deadly attacks launched by militants.

No militant group has yet claimed responsibility for the attack although several groups fighting the government are active in the area.
